Manager, Business Intelligence
Start a Rewarding Career with Alliant
What will your day look like?
You will be responsible to provide hands-on guidance and lead the team to turn raw data into reports and dashboards to help leadership and business better understand performance and drive strategic and tactical decision-making abilities. The manager collaborates with all channel owners and various cross functional teams such as Marketing, Risk, Finance and Member Services to collaboratively influence strategies and decision making. In addition, the incumbent helps the team to build capacity to improve risk monitoring and business reporting for both holistic and granular views throughout the life cycle of loans. This manager is also responsible for driving solutions that require bringing together data from various data sources and working across many different teams of the organization. Resources to do the job require reliance on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als utilizing a highly analytical mindset and a wide degree of latitude. General direction is received from the Senior Manager, Decision Science and Insight.
